#4cb3c0 basic color information

#4cb3c0

In the RGB color model, hex triplet #4cb3c0 has decimal index of: 5026752, is composed of 29.8% red, 70.2% green and 75.3% blue. #4cb3c0 in CMYK color model, is composed of 60.4% cyan, 6.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 24.7% black.
#33cccc is the closest web-safe color to #4cb3c0.

Analogous colors

They are colors that are next to each other on the color wheel. Analogous colors tend to look pleasant together, because they are closely related.
